CannSell – Supported Certification Workshop
Digital Classroom in Port Cares 92 Charlotte Street, Port Colborne, Ontario, CanadaThe CannSell Standard Certification is the only training program approved for legally authorized cannabis retailers in Ontario. Ontario law requires that all employees of cannabis retail stores, store managers, and cannabis retail license holders must complete the CannSell certification before their first day of work.
